WitrynaThe Great Salt Lake, located in the northern part of the U.S. state of Utah, is the largest salt water lake in the Western Hemisphere, and the eighth-largest terminal lake in the world. In an average year the lake covers an area of around 4,400 km 2, but the lake's size fluctuates substantially due to its shallowness. Witryna18 lip 2024 · ABC News. They flow into the Saint … briarcliff home for adults bathWitryna28 lip 2024 · Great Salt Lake of Utah is among the largest and most ecologically important water bodies in North America. Since the late 1950s, the lake has been divided into two hydrologically distinct water bodies by a rock-fill railroad causeway.
